if(description)
{
script_id(703532);
script_version("$Revision: 6608 $");
script_cve_id("CVE-2016-2342");
script_name("Debian Security Advisory DSA 3532-1 (quagga - security update)");
script_tag(name: "last_modification", value: "$Date: 2017-07-07 14:05:05 +0200 (Fri, 07 Jul 2017) $");
script_tag(name: "creation_date", value: "2016-03-27 00:00:00 +0100 (Sun, 27 Mar 2016)");
script_tag(name:"cvss_base", value:"7.6");
script_tag(name:"cvss_base_vector", value:"AV:N/AC:H/Au:N/C:C/I:C/A:C");
script_tag(name: "solution_type", value: "VendorFix");
script_tag(name: "qod_type", value: "package");
script_xref(name: "URL", value: "http://www.debian.org/security/2016/dsa-3532.html");
script_category(ACT_GATHER_INFO);
script_copyright("Copyright (c) 2016 Greenbone Networks GmbH http://greenbone.net");
script_family("Debian Local Security Checks");
script_dependencies("gather-package-list.nasl");
script_mandatory_keys("ssh/login/debian_linux", "ssh/login/packages");
script_tag(name: "affected", value: "quagga on Debian Linux");
script_tag(name: "insight", value: "GNU Quagga is free software which
manages TCP/IP based routing protocols. It supports BGP4, BGP4+, OSPFv2, OSPFv3,
IS-IS, RIPv1, RIPv2, and RIPng as well as the IPv6 versions of these.");
script_tag(name: "solution", value: "For the oldstable distribution (wheezy),
this problem has been fixed in version 0.99.22.4-1+wheezy2.
For the stable distribution (jessie), this problem has been fixed in
version 0.99.23.1-1+deb8u1.
We recommend that you upgrade your quagga packages.");
script_tag(name: "summary", value: "Kostya Kortchinsky discovered a
stack-based buffer overflow vulnerability in the VPNv4 NLRI parser in bgpd in
quagga, a BGP/OSPF/RIP routing daemon. A remote attacker can exploit this flaw to
cause a denial of service (daemon crash), or potentially, execution of arbitrary
code, if bgpd is configured with BGP peers enabled for VPNv4.");
script_tag(name: "vuldetect", value: "This check tests the installed software
version using the apt package manager.");
exit(0);
}
include("revisions-lib.inc");
include("pkg-lib-deb.inc");
res = "";
report = "";
if ((res = isdpkgvuln(pkg:"quagga", ver:"0.99.22.4-1+wheezy2", rls_regex:"DEB7.[0-9]+")) != NULL) {
report += res;
}
if ((res = isdpkgvuln(pkg:"quagga-dbg", ver:"0.99.22.4-1+wheezy2", rls_regex:"DEB7.[0-9]+")) != NULL) {
report += res;
}
if ((res = isdpkgvuln(pkg:"quagga-doc", ver:"0.99.22.4-1+wheezy2", rls_regex:"DEB7.[0-9]+")) != NULL) {
report += res;
}
if ((res = isdpkgvuln(pkg:"quagga", ver:"0.99.23.1-1+deb8u1", rls_regex:"DEB8.[0-9]+")) != NULL) {
report += res;
}
if ((res = isdpkgvuln(pkg:"quagga-dbg", ver:"0.99.23.1-1+deb8u1", rls_regex:"DEB8.[0-9]+")) != NULL) {
report += res;
}
if ((res = isdpkgvuln(pkg:"quagga-doc", ver:"0.99.23.1-1+deb8u1", rls_regex:"DEB8.[0-9]+")) != NULL) {
report += res;
}
if (report != "") {
security_message(data:report);
} else if (__pkg_match) {
exit(99); # Not vulnerable.
}
